Transaction 1296bc62d17e500c48cd3531d33dbd103b07957421c9f92bf5380ec50957f165
1 Input
2 Outputs
- 1296bc62d17e500c48cd3531d33dbd103b07957421c9f92bf5380ec50957f165:0
- 1296bc62d17e500c48cd3531d33dbd103b07957421c9f92bf5380ec50957f165:1
value 8864099
address 1EmTGGwvRmscXPDvSTv3BbKkgTbrHQUtrj
value 1149744523
address 13WMjvvpTPeN6gjpq3vpVszj6uEf68hQCM